Nest is a global nonprofit organization committed to reversing systemic social and economic inequities for women and historically marginalized communities around the world through investment in handwork. Currently serving over 2,000 artisan businesses, Nest’s comprehensive range of programming is designed to meet the artisan and maker partners where they are. The Ethical Handcraft Training Program is an industry-wide transparency and training program for production taking place beyond the four-walled factory (i.e., small workshops and homes). Currently, the program impacts over 51,000 handworkers in 27 countries worldwide, revolutionizing the industry by making homework a safe and viable option.
